HE took on the Daleks, the Cybermen and the Master. Now Dr Who has defeated his greatest foe — Britain's biggest police force.

The BBC has won a six-year battle with Scotland Yard over the trademark rights of Dr Who's famous Tardis police box, it was revealed yesterday.

Patent Office chiefs decided the old-style boxes are now "more associated with the TV series" than with the Metropolitan Police.

The ruling allows the BBC to use the Tardis image on Dr Who merchandise, including computer games, pencil cases, books and clothing. A Scotland Yard spokesman said yesterday: "We're disappointed but philosophical."
